hi!
i had beryl working. after my last update deep world it refuse to start or actually it kind of works:
when started i can rotate the cube but everything that should be shown on the desktop is not visible to me.
but everything works the way it is intended to. i just can't see it. for example i can open a terminal (via shortcut) and execute commands. (killall kdm or reboot,....)
and another interessting thing: the mouse cursor adapts to its context as usual. if i open up a kwrite window the "standard"-cursor turns into a "text"-cursor if i move the mouse over the (invisible) window an it changes back if i leave the window.
it works, but i can't see it. just a "screenshot"...
the following packages were updated:
libXfixes (x11/libs)
inputproto (x11/proto)
randrproto (x11/proto)
libXi (x11/libs)
libXrandr (x11/libs)
libXdamage (x11/libs)
libXcomposite (x11/libs)
dbus-glib (dev/libs)
man (sys-apps)
alsa-headers (media-sound)
any ideas what could cause that problem or how to fix it??

It did not do the job for me .
I even tried to re-emerge the whole beryl, xorg-x11, libX11 and nvidia-drivers, with no luck. I also tried to reboot the computer (!), but beryl only want to acknowledge kwin WM.
Maybe I shall try downgrade some of the libraries that got upgraded?!
Edit:
Actually, i did mask Code: | =x11-proto/randrproto-1.2.0
=x11-libs/libXrandr-1.2.1 |
and did emerge -uDN world, and now beryl is working again .
But thats only a dirty woraround. |
